반응형

2020/05/09 30

텍스트 인코딩을 결정하는 방법은 무엇입니까?

텍스트 인코딩을 결정하는 방법은 무엇입니까? 인코딩 된 텍스트를 받았지만 어떤 문자 집합이 사용되었는지 알 수 없습니다. 파이썬을 사용하여 텍스트 파일의 인코딩을 결정하는 방법이 있습니까? C #을 처리 하는 텍스트 파일의 인코딩 / 코드 페이지를 어떻게 감지합니까 ? 인코딩을 항상 올바르게 감지하는 것은 불가능 합니다. (chardet FAQ에서 :) 그러나 일부 인코딩은 특정 언어에 최적화되어 있으며 언어는 임의적이지 않습니다. 일부 문자 시퀀스는 항상 팝업되지만 다른 시퀀스는 의미가 없습니다. 신문을 개봉하고 "txzqJv 2! dasd0a QqdKjvz"를 발견 한 영어에 능숙한 사람은 영어가 아님을 완전히 인식합니다 (영어로만 구성되어 있음에도 불구하고). 많은 "일반적인"텍스트를 연구함으로써 ..

Programing 2020.05.09

SQL에서 count (column)과 count (*)의 차이점은 무엇입니까?

SQL에서 count (column)과 count (*)의 차이점은 무엇입니까? 다음과 같은 쿼리가 있습니다. select column_name, count(column_name) from table group by column_name having count(column_name) > 1; 에 대한 모든 통화를 교체하면 어떤 차이 count(column_name)가 count(*)있습니까? 이 질문은 Oracle의 테이블에서 중복 값 을 어떻게 찾습니까? . 허용 대답 (어쩌면 내 질문에) 명확히하기 위해, 교체 count(column_name)와 함께하는 count(*)이 포함 된 결과에 추가 행을 반환 null과의 수 null열의 값을. count(*)널 (null)을 카운트 count(column..

Programing 2020.05.09

C ++에서 int를 열거 형으로 캐스팅하는 방법은 무엇입니까?

C ++에서 int를 열거 형으로 캐스팅하는 방법은 무엇입니까? C ++에서 int를 열거 형으로 캐스팅하는 방법은 무엇입니까? 예를 들면 다음과 같습니다. enum Test { A, B }; int a = 1; a유형으로 변환 하려면 어떻게합니까 Test::A? int i = 1; Test val = static_cast(i); Test e = static_cast(1); 귀하의 코드 enum Test { A, B } int a = 1; 해결책 Test castEnum = static_cast(a); 마지막 질문을 던지 면서 거기에 캐스트Test::A 가 있어야한다는 요구 사항에 대해 단단하지 않고 "어떻게 유형을 변환합니까?"라는 질문을 던 졌습니다. C ++ 11 표준에 따라 : 5.2.9 정적 캐..

Programing 2020.05.09

String replace ()와 replaceAll ()의 차이점

String replace ()와 replaceAll ()의 차이점 나중에 정규식을 사용하는 것 외에 java.lang.String replace()과 replaceAll()메소드 의 차이점은 무엇입니까 ? 교체 같은 간단한 대체의 경우 .와 /어떤 차이가? 에서 java.lang.String의 replace방법은 두 문자의 한 쌍 또는 한 쌍의 소요 CharSequence(이 행복하게 문자열의 한 쌍을거야, 그래서 문자열 서브 클래스로되어있는) '들. 이 replace메소드는 모든 문자 또는를 대체합니다 CharSequence. 반면에, 모두 String인수 replaceFirst하고 replaceAll정규 표현식 (정규식을)입니다. 잘못된 기능을 사용하면 미묘한 버그가 발생할 수 있습니다. Q : 나..

Programing 2020.05.09

좋은 Python ORM 솔루션은 무엇입니까?

좋은 Python ORM 솔루션은 무엇입니까? [닫은] 저는 기본적으로 백엔드의 Python 웹 서비스와 통신하는 클라이언트 측 (브라우저)의 JavaScript 프론트 엔드 프로젝트에 CherryPy를 사용하고 평가하고 있습니다. 따라서 백엔드에는 실제로 Python을 사용하여 구현할 수있는 ORZ (브라우저의 JSON)를 통해 PostgreSQL DB와 통신 할 수있는 빠르고 가벼운 것이 필요합니다. ORM이 내장되어 있기 때문에 내가 좋아하는 Django 도보 고 있습니다. 그러나 장고는 내가 필요로하는 것보다 조금 더 많을 수도 있다고 생각합니다 (즉, 실제로 필요한 것보다 더 많은 기능 == 느림). 누구나 다른 Python ORM 솔루션에 대한 경험이 있으십니까? 기능과 속도, 효율성 등을 비..

Programing 2020.05.09

마크 다운 테이블의 줄 바꿈?

마크 다운 테이블의 줄 바꿈? 마크 다운 테이블에 다음 셀이 있습니다. |Something|Something else that's rather long|Something else| 가운데 줄에 줄 바꿈을 삽입 할 수 있기를 원하므로 열이 너무 크지 않습니다. Markdown에서 어떻게 할 수 있습니까? 대신 HTML 테이블을 사용해야합니까? 테이블 셀 내에서 줄 바꿈을 강제하는 데 사용 합니다. Markdown Extra 및 MultiMarkdown은 테이블을 허용하지만 시행 착오 후에이 경우 HTML 줄 바꿈이 필요한 것 같습니다. HTML로 내보낼 때 작동합니다. 그러나 pandoc을 사용하여 LaTeX / PDF로 내보내는 경우 그리드 테이블을 사용해야 합니다 . +---------------+--..

Programing 2020.05.09

힘내 : "당신이 누구인지 알려주세요"오류

힘내 : "당신이 누구인지 알려주세요"오류 Chef + 일부 임시 bash 스크립트를 사용하여 함께 부트 스트랩하는 앱 서버가 있습니다. 문제는 이러한 앱 서버 중 하나에서 업데이트를 실행하려고 할 때 얻는 것입니다. 19:00:28: *** Please tell me who you are. Run git config --global user.email "you@example.com" git config --global user.name "Your Name" git pull origin master앱 서버를 업데이트 할 때마다 간단한 작업을 수행하려면 실제로 설정해야 합니까? 이름과 이메일이 설정되지 않은 경우 오류가 발생하지 않도록이 동작을 무시할 수 있습니까? PHP 스크립트를 호출하여 git을 초기..

Programing 2020.05.09

Windows의 로컬 파일 시스템에서 GIT 복제 저장소

Windows의 로컬 파일 시스템에서 GIT 복제 저장소 GIT에 관해서는 완전한 Noob입니다. 지난 며칠 동안 첫 발걸음을 내딛었습니다. 랩톱에 저장소를 설정하고 SVN 프로젝트에서 트렁크를 가져 왔습니다 (분기에 문제가 있었지만 작동하지 않았습니다). 이제 랩탑에서 메인 데스크탑으로 당기거나 밀어 낼 수 있기를 원합니다. 노트북을 사용하는 이유는 하루 2 시간 씩 여행하면서 기차에서 편리하며 좋은 일을 할 수 있습니다. 그러나 집에있는 메인 머신은 개발하기에 좋습니다. 집에 도착했을 때 랩탑에서 메인 컴퓨터로 밀거나 당길 수 있기를 원합니다. 이 작업을 수행하는 가장 간단한 방법은 코드 폴더를 LAN을 통해 공유하고 수행하는 것입니다. git clone file://192.168.10.51/code..

Programing 2020.05.09

DLL 파일이란 무엇이며 어떻게 작동합니까?

DLL 파일이란 무엇이며 어떻게 작동합니까? DLL 파일은 정확히 어떻게 작동합니까? 그것들이 끔찍한 것처럼 보이지만 나는 그들이 무엇인지, 어떻게 작동하는지 모르겠습니다. 그래서 그들과의 거래는 무엇입니까? DLL이란 무엇입니까? DLL (Dynamic Link Libraries)은 EXE와 유사하지만 직접 실행할 수는 없습니다. Linux / Unix의 .so 파일과 비슷합니다. 즉, DLL은 MS가 공유 라이브러리를 구현 한 것입니다. DLL은 EXE와 매우 유사하여 파일 형식 자체가 동일합니다. EXE 및 DLL은 모두 PE (Portable Executable) 파일 형식을 기반으로합니다. DLL은 COM 구성 요소 및 .NET 라이브러리도 포함 할 수 있습니다. DLL은 무엇을 포함합니까? D..

Programing 2020.05.09

varargs 메서드 매개 변수에 ArrayList를 전달하는 방법은 무엇입니까?

varargs 메서드 매개 변수에 ArrayList를 전달하는 방법은 무엇입니까? 기본적으로 위치의 ArrayList가 있습니다. ArrayList locations = new ArrayList(); 이 아래에서 나는 다음과 같은 방법을 호출 .getMap(); getMap () 메소드의 매개 변수는 다음과 같습니다. getMap(WorldLocation... locations) 내가 겪고있는 문제는 그 방법에 대한 전체 목록을 전달하는 방법을 잘 모르겠다 locations는 것입니다. 난 노력 했어 .getMap(locations.toArray()) 그러나 getMap은 Objects []를 허용하지 않으므로이를 허용하지 않습니다. 이제 내가 사용하면 .getMap(locations.get(0)); 그..

Programing 2020.05.09
반응형